in louisville we have lost most of the rock stations, we still have 2 that use the term "Classic Rock", but even one of them has started mixing 80's hair metal bands in the format.

The Fox ( Foxrocks.com) is the only so-called rock station left that plays rock from the 70's til today.

recently WLRS, which was the only channel that played mainly 90's till today and local bands , switched to some talk radio format.

now another channel that has been hits from the 80's and 90's , basically songs that you would remember seeing videos of when MTV was MTV. You go from hearing REM to John Cougar to Men At Work to Madonna to Devo to The Go-Go's to Van Halen to Prince to , well you get the point. But now it is supposed to switch to a Gen-X station, basically mix that same format in with Grunge hits and Punk rock and hair metal. Basically they are claiming they are trying to mix all genres of music hits that Gen-Xer's remember.
